首页数据库数据库数据迁移方案 mysql数据库迁移方案

数据库数据迁移方案 mysql数据库迁移方案

编程之家2026-05-19674次浏览

这篇文章给大家聊聊关于数据库数据迁移方案,以及mysql数据库迁移方案对应的知识点,希望对各位有所帮助,不要忘了收藏本站哦。

数据库数据迁移方案 mysql数据库迁移方案

oracle数据库迁移方案 文档怎么写

Oracle数据库迁移文档可以按如下格式进行写:

一、需求分析:

数据库所有文件(数据文件、日志文件、临时文件、控制文件)都存放在光纤存储中,但是光纤存储使用时间过长,超过3年,经常出现一些问题,而且光纤存储需要厂家维护,维护方面不是很方便,需要将数据库文件迁移到nas存储中。

二、操作步骤:

1:具体需求

2:保存现有数据文件、控制文件、临时文件、日志文件位置

数据库数据迁移方案 mysql数据库迁移方案

3:停止监听,并关闭数据库

4:移动所有数据文件、控制文件、临时文件、日志文件到新的位置

5:启动数据库到nomount状态,并更改控制文件位置,关闭数据库

6:启动数据库到mount状态

7:更改数据文件、临时文件、日志文件位置

7:打开数据库

数据库数据迁移方案 mysql数据库迁移方案

8:重启验证

请教高手4T的数据库迁移方案

方法一:

将\Microsoft SQL Server\MSSQL\DATA文件夹中的syntt_data.mdf和syntt_log.ldf文件复制到安装有数据库服务器的机器的文件夹中(可以是本机的\Microsoft SQL Server\MSSQL\DATA\文件夹),然后进入企业管理器。右键点击逗数据库地,在浮动菜单中选择逗所有任务地中的逗附加数据库地。

在随后的提示页面中选择刚才复制过来的.MDF文件,如果想指定数据库的所有者,在逗指定数据库所有者地选择框中选择你认为合适的用户。如果想修改数据库的名字,可在逗附加为地框中输入新的数据库名字(对本数据库,不建议这么做,因为这样的话,整个程序中所有涉及数据库连接的代码都要随之修改,那将是不必要的劳动)。

在进行完上述的工作之后,直接点击逗确定地就可进行数据的SQL Server数据转移转移。

方法二:

(方法一)是针对数据库中没有本数据库的服务器,如果数据库中已经建有与该数据库名称相同的数据库,则直接按照备份数据库的恢复操作就可完成数据的SQL Server数据转移转移。

方法如下所述:

这种方法首先要在本机上建立一个备份文件,具体操作介绍如下:

1、在企业管理器中打开服务器组以及指定的服务器。然后右键点击需要备份的数据库在这里是syntt,在浮动菜单中选择逗所有任务地菜单下的逗备份数据库地,打开数据备份对话框。

2、选择逗常规地选项卡,在名称对话框中输入本分集合名称,在逗描述地文本框中输入备份集描述文本信息。在逗备份地组下选择备份操作类型,共有以下几种:

数据库—完全:完整备份数据库。

数据库—差异:增量备份数据库。

事务日志:事务日志备份。

文件和文件组:数据库文件和文件组备份。

在逗目的地组中指定备份设备或者备份文件名称,选择逗添加地按钮添加备份设备或者文件;逗删除地按钮用来删除备份设备和备份文件;选择逗内容地按钮,则可查看已经存储在备份设备或文件中的备份信息。

在逗重写地组中有两种选项:

追加到媒体:选择该选项,表示需要保存备份设备或文件中以前的备份数据。

重写现有媒体:要求本次被分数据覆盖以前的备份数据,从而节省存储空间。

在逗调度地组中,安排数据备份的时间。用来指定数据库备份在将来的某个时间执行

3、逗选项地选项卡,设置数据库备份操作选项。其中的内容主要有以下几项:

完成后验证备份:要求在备份结束时对备份数据进行校验。

备份后弹出磁带:只对磁带备份设备有效,他要求在备份结束时自动卸带。

删除事务日志中不活动的条目:要求在事务日志备份结束时删除事务日志中的已经完成的事务日志条目。

检查媒体集名称和备份集到期时间:要求在备份前检查介质集名称和原备份集中备份SQL Server数据转移的有效期,以防止意外重写破坏原来的备份数据。

备份集到期时间:设置备份集的有效期。

初始化并标识媒体:只对磁带设备有效。选择该选项后,SQL Server在备份时将Microsoft定义的磁带格式信息写入介质的开始部分。此时,可以在逗媒体集名称地和逗媒体集描述地文本框中定义介质集名称和介质描述信息。

4、在进行完上述的操作之后,剩下的任务就是点击逗确定地,使系统开始进行数据库的备份操作。

到目前为止,我们已经有了一个数据库的备份文件,剩下的任务就是怎么将这个文件还原至另外的数据库服务器中了。

1、因为使用企业管理器进行数据库的恢复只能是在本机进行,所以在进行数据还原之前,必须将刚才所作的备份文件复制到本机,然后在本机选择逗syntt地数据库,右键点击它,在显示出来的浮动菜单中选择逗所有任务地下的逗还原数据库地。

2、在还原数据库对话框中,在逗常规地选项卡中的选择逗从设备地的数据恢复方法,通过逗选择设备地按钮选择刚才复制过来的文件。

逗常规地选项卡与逗选项地选项卡中的具体内容如下所示:

逗常规地选项卡:

数据库恢复方法:包括逗数据库地、逗文件组或文件地、逗从设备地三种恢复方式。

逗数据库地方式:选择该项时,从逗显示数据库备份地列表中选择需要显示的指定数据库备份集合,从逗要还原的第一个备份地列表框中选择首先使用哪一个备份集恢复数据库;逗文件组或文件地:选择它时,数据库恢复部件列出指定数据库备份集合中备份的数据库文件或文件组,管理员可从这些备份文件中选择恢复那个数据库文件或文件组;逗从设备地:选择它时,管理员选择恢复数据库或其日志所使用的备份设备,之后再从该备份设备中选择使用哪一次备份中的数据恢复数据库或其日志。

3、点击逗确定地,完成恢复操作。

非原创

数据库迁移可以通过什么技术实现

数据迁移的实现可以分为3个阶段:数据迁移前的准备、数据迁移的实施和数据迁移后的校验。由于数据迁移的特点,大量的工作都需要在准备阶段完成,充分而周到的准备工作是完成数据迁移的主要基础。

具体而言,要进行待迁移数据源的详细说明(包括数据的存储方式、数据量、数据的时间跨度);建立新旧系统数据库的数据字典;

对旧系统的历史数据进行质量分析,新旧系统数据结构的差异分析;

新旧系统代码数据的差异分析;

建立新老系统数据库表的映射关系,对无法映射字段的处理方法;

开发、部属ETL工具,编写数据转换的测试计划和校验程序;

制定数据转换的应急措施。

其中,数据迁移的实施是实现数据迁移的3个阶段中最重要的环节。

它要求制定数据转换的详细实施步骤流程;

准备数据迁移环境;业务上的准备,结束未处理完的业务事项,或将其告一段落;对数据迁移涉及的技术都得到测试;最后实施数据迁移。

数据迁移后的校验是对迁移工作的检查,数据校验的结果是判断新系统能否正式启用的重要依据。可以通过质量检查工具或编写检查程序进行数据校验,通过试运行新系统的功能模块,特别是查询、报表功能,检查数据的准确性。

好了,文章到这里就结束啦,如果本次分享的数据库数据迁移方案和mysql数据库迁移方案问题对您有所帮助,还望关注下本站哦!

thinkphp开源cms系统?thinkphp导航源码网上商城系统源代码 网上购物商城HTML源代码